The art is nice, the characters are interesting, and the premise is pretty cool. That said, aside from one error of logic during the inciting incident (not being able to leave the room when in reality he just didn't want to), which could be a translation issue, the plot—as slow and meandering as it is—is solid.
It's not meant for everyone, as it does drag on, but I liked it enough.
